What companies run services between Nuremberg, Germany and Matera, Italy?

You can take a train from Nürnberg Hbf to Matera Centrale Station via München Hbf, Bologna Centrale, Bari Centrale, and Altamura in around 18h 36m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Nuremberg central bus station to Matera via Munich central bus station and Bari in around 22h 20m.
